What Is a Quick Resume?
A quick resume is a professionally structured document created in a short amount of time—usually under an hour—while still maintaining clarity, relevance, and impact. It focuses on efficiency without compromising on quality.
Unlike rushed or poorly written resumes, a quick resume relies on proven frameworks and pre-prepared content. It emphasizes key information such as skills, experience, and achievements while eliminating unnecessary details.
Key Characteristics
- Concise and focused content
- Clean and simple formatting
- Keyword-optimized for ATS systems
- Tailored for a specific job role

Essential Elements of a Fast Resume
Even when creating a resume quickly, certain elements are non-negotiable. Missing these can reduce your chances of landing interviews.
| Section | Purpose | Tips |
|---|---|---|
| Contact Information | Allows employers to reach you | Keep it simple and updated |
| Summary | Highlights your value | Write 2–3 impactful sentences |
| Experience | Shows your background | Use bullet points with achievements |
| Skills | Demonstrates capabilities | Match with job description |
Checklist: Must-Have Sections
- ✔ Professional summary
- ✔ Relevant work experience
- ✔ Key skills
- ✔ Education
- ✔ Certifications (if applicable)

Step-by-Step Process to Create a Resume Quickly
Creating a resume quickly doesn’t mean skipping steps—it means optimizing them. Follow this streamlined process:
1. Gather Your Information
List your previous jobs, achievements, and skills. Keep it brief.
2. Choose a Template
Use a simple, ATS-friendly format.
3. Write a Strong Summary
Highlight your top achievements and skills.
4. Add Experience
Focus on results, not just duties.
5. Optimize for Keywords
Match your resume to the job description.
| Step | Time Needed |
|---|---|
| Information Gathering | 10 minutes |
| Writing Summary | 5 minutes |
| Adding Experience | 20 minutes |
| Editing | 10 minutes |
Use pre-written bullet points and adapt them quickly for each job application.

Best Resume Formats for Speed
Choosing the right format can save you significant time.
| Format | Best For | Speed |
|---|---|---|
| Chronological | Experienced professionals | Fast |
| Functional | Career changers | Moderate |
| Combination | Mixed experience | Slower |
Recommendation
The chronological format is the fastest and most widely accepted.
Overcomplicating design. Fancy layouts slow you down and may fail ATS scans.

Time-Saving Resume Writing Tips
Efficiency is all about smart shortcuts. Here are proven tips:
- Use bullet points instead of paragraphs
- Reuse previous resume content
- Focus on measurable achievements
- Limit your resume to one page (if possible)
- Use action verbs (e.g., managed, developed, improved)
Create a master resume file. Then copy and customize it for each job.
Checklist: Quick Optimization
- ✔ Tailored keywords included
- ✔ No spelling errors
- ✔ Consistent formatting
- ✔ Clear section headings

Common Mistakes to Avoid
When working fast, it’s easy to make mistakes that hurt your chances.
Submitting the same resume for every job. Always customize.
Ignoring keywords from the job description.
Using long paragraphs instead of concise bullet points.
Top Errors Table
| Mistake | Impact |
|---|---|
| Generic resume | Low response rate |
| Poor formatting | Hard to read |
| No achievements | Weak impression |
Always review your resume once before submitting—even a quick proofread can make a big difference.
Quick Resume Checklist
Use this checklist before sending your resume:
- ✔ Tailored to the job description
- ✔ Includes measurable achievements
- ✔ Free of spelling and grammar errors
- ✔ Easy-to-read format
- ✔ Updated contact information

FAQ
1. How fast can I create a resume?
You can create a strong resume in 30–60 minutes using templates and pre-written content.
2. Can a quick resume still be effective?
Yes, if it’s focused, tailored, and well-structured.
3. Should I include all my experience?
No, only include relevant roles and achievements.
4. What is the best format for a quick resume?
The chronological format is the fastest and most effective.
5. How do I optimize for ATS?
Use keywords from the job description and avoid complex formatting.
6. Do I need a cover letter?
Yes, in most cases. It increases your chances of getting noticed.
